For most white Superheroes their race really isn't a core part of their character, there are exceptions of course but most could be ANY race and still work. Batman in particular could be any race and the story still works completely.

With many black Superheros their race is a part of their origin and concept. Many of those characters were created specifically to add black characters to comics.

People tend to do a false equivalency when it comes to this arguing that changing either is equally wrong, ignoring the fact that there is a SIGNIFICANTLY smaller pool black characters than white characters so turning a black character white is far more detrimental.

There's a huge amount of racial discrimination that goes on with major comic book publishers. There are tons of black comic book writers out there who aren't getting work. Even the ones who did get a shot at working for the big publishers have spoken out about black writers aren't given opportunities.

When Dwayne McDuffie died you saw a Marvel and DC hop on his dikk and praise him as one of the most brilliant writers of his generation, but when he was alive neither company wanted to consistently give him work, and he was given work editorial would constantly fukk with him.

Christopher Priest is another guy that editors at the big two constantly praise and say they'd LOVE to have working for him, but according to Priest nobody ever calls him to work on stuff, and during his time at both companies he dealt with all kinds of liberal racism. Priest has essentially been blackballed from the industry.

Then I've read and heard multiple stories by multiple creators where they said they'd correspond with editors over the phone or through email about job opportunities but when they show up for the face the face the job has suddenly been filled. Also there's supposedly a group of well known racists in the industry that most black creators all seem to know about.

And that's not even taking into account the way that some comic book fans can be. If fans know a comic book writer is black they WILL shyt on them constantly and accuse the writer of racism for using more than one black character and shoving racial issues down their throats.
